Which One Is Right for You?
Golden Goat and MAC are both excellent strains with distinct characteristics. Golden Goat is a Sativa with 16–23% THC, while MAC is a Hybrid with 14–20% THC. Your choice depends on your preference for effects, growing difficulty, and intended use.
Choose Golden Goat
Choose Golden Goat if you want higher THC potency, broader medical applications. Golden Goat which was created 'accidentally' is a sativa dominant hybrid strain of medical marijuana.
Choose MAC
MAC is a solid hybrid with relaxing, happy, uplifting effects.
